Argentinian media TYC Sports reported Ronaldo’s purchase of a new club, citing the Portuguese media MyFootball portal. Now Ronaldo is going to buy a third-division club in Portugal.
Ronaldo, a member of Brazil’s 2002 World Cup winning team, bought the ownership of a club for the first time in 2018. The former footballer, known as ‘The Phenomenon’, became the owner of the club for the first time after buying 51 percent of the shares of the Spanish club Real Valladolid. He currently owns 82 percent of the club. The club has struggled to stay in the top tier of Spanish football since Ronaldo’s purchase. In this season, the club is at number 14 with 28 points in 25 matches.
Then Ronaldo bought his childhood club Cruzeiro in 2021. However, after Spain and Brazil, this one of the best footballers of all time wants to expand his business in Portugal. For that purpose, Ronaldo focused on buying the club of Cristiano Ronaldo’s country. The third division club in Portugal that Ronaldo wants to buy call Amora.
Going to buy the Portuguese club
Ronaldo has been trying to enter the Portuguese football market for the past few years. He wants to complete that task with Amora. Spanish group own currently 75 percent of Odemira Kaptil The club.
A man named Josmar Gallego run the company. Amora is located 20 kilometers from Lisbon. The club has had the opportunity to play at the top level only 3 times in its history of more than 100 years. From 1979 to 1981 this club was coached by Jose Mourinho’s father, Jose Manuel Mourinho.
